The Pamlico Indians utilized a variety of tools made from natural materials found in their environment. They crafted wooden tools for fishing and hunting, such as spears and fish traps, and used stone tools for cutting and scraping. Additionally, they made baskets and pottery for storage and cooking. These tools were essential for their daily survival and reflected their deep connection to the land and resources around them.
